About the job

The Red Hat Customer Content Services (CCS) team is looking for a content strategist to join us in Bangalore, India. The content strategist plays a critical role in making Red Hat's product documentation a competitive differentiator. The content strategist leads the creation and implementation of a comprehensive strategy that defines content deliverables to support key business objectives and reviews high-level development scoping information to determine initial resource requirements. The content strategist works with the functional program, content services teams, and customer experience groups to ensure content meets the needs of all internal stakeholders and, most importantly, provides an outstanding customer experience.

What you will do

  • Lead people and projects in an open way that inspires confidence. Demonstrate negotiation, leadership and influencing capabilities.
  • Reviews high-level development scoping information and determines initial resource requirements to support initiatives. 
  • Develop, socialize, and get approval for plans to achieve the quality standards and drive/support successful  implementation of content plans and initiatives.
  • Lead or participate in special initiatives and change efforts for the Customer Content Services team. 
  • Assess the audience for your program deliverables and presentations and communicate clearly, concisely, confidently and effectively in written and verbal communications.
  • Demonstrate complex problem solving skills in resolving cross-functional issues within the program and documentation teams and negotiation
  • Independently manage the Content Strategy for releases.
  • Develop, publish, and get approval for a content strategy plan of record from stakeholders and the documentation team members.
  • Define recommendations on content standards, needed improvements, and content gaps. Prioritize customer-related bugs and feedback from customer-facing stakeholders for continuous improvement efforts 
  • Understand the impact of content decisions and strategy, not just within Customer Content Services but also to areas across Red Hat, like Support Delivery.
  • Curate content for display on the product page in the Red Hat website for each product release. 
  • Act as single point of contact for stakeholders, provide Content Services approvals to program management teams, report status and negotiate changes to deliverables and schedules, communicate and get buy-in for the content plan to all relevant stakeholders. 
  • Work with Support Product Leads to establish "content readiness" for new product releases and present content highlights and challenges during quarterly service reviews and program meetings. 

What you will bring

  • 5+ years experience working with enterprise software documentation, either as a technical writer, information architect or content strategist
  • Familiarity with structured, topic-based authoring, information architecture
  • Experience working with diverse sets of stakeholders to solve complex problems
  • Ability to influence irrespective of job title
  • Familiarity with Red Hat's product portfolio a plus
  • Experience in the enterprise software industry, including an understanding of the customer lifecycle and knowledge of different content development and publishing methodologies, tools, and defect-tracking systems
